Output 510b283244204c3a0d67bdc1f572b416a9d91609889f34ba68c322ddd56a13fc:0

value
661685280
script pubkey
OP_HASH160 OP_PUSHBYTES_20 82b6bd361d1c3d3b8ba82df9475162cd7be19525 OP_EQUAL
address
3DcAgRAZanTQuwdatCTTWaXBEDiXL5puey
transaction
510b283244204c3a0d67bdc1f572b416a9d91609889f34ba68c322ddd56a13fc
spent
true